Selecting the Right Paint and Tools
Wondering which repaint and tools are best for your indoor paint job? When it involves selecting the appropriate paint, take into consideration elements like the kind of surface you're repainting, the preferred surface, and the shade options offered. For wall surfaces, a latex paint is often the best selection due to its resilience, easy clean-up, and quick drying time. If you're painting a high-traffic area like a corridor or kitchen area, a semi-gloss or satin finish may be better as they're less complicated to clean up.
As for devices, investing in top notch brushes and rollers can make a considerable difference in the final end result of your paint job. Search for brushes with dense bristles that are suitable for the type of paint you're using. Roller covers come in various nap dimensions, with much shorter naps being optimal for smooth surface areas like wall surfaces and ceilings, while longer naps are better for distinctive surface areas.
Readying Your Area for Painting
To ensure a successful indoor painting project, appropriate preparation of your area is crucial. Next, take down any kind of decorations, change plates, and outlet covers. Use painter's tape to safeguard baseboards, trim, and any kind of locations you don't wish to repaint. Fill up openings and fractures in the wall surfaces with spackling compound, after that sand them smooth once dry. Dust and tidy the walls to guarantee correct paint adhesion.
After preparing the walls, put down drop cloths to secure your floorings. If you're painting the ceiling, cover the whole floor area with drop cloths, safeguarding them in position with painter's tape. Make sure correct air flow by opening up home windows or using followers to help with drying out and to lessen the fumes. Lastly, gather all your painting products in one area to have every little thing you need within reach. Putting in the time to prepare your room will certainly make the paint process smoother and help you achieve an expert finish.
Executing the Painting Refine
Begin by choosing the proper paint color and finish for the room you're painting. Think about the mood you wish to develop and exactly how natural light influences the shade throughout the day. Once you have your paint, gather high-grade brushes, rollers, painter's tape, and drop cloths. Prior to beginning, make sure the walls are tidy and dry.
Begin by cutting in the sides of the walls and around trim with a brush. Then, use a roller to cover larger locations, operating in little areas. Keep in mind to maintain a damp side to avoid noticeable lap marks. When painting doors and trim, utilize a smaller sized brush for precision. Work methodically, using slim, also coats. Remove the painter's tape while the paint is still a little wet to prevent peeling.
Enable the paint to completely dry completely before moving furniture back into area. Take your time and pay attention to information for a remarkable finish that will transform the look of your room.
